On Stand B30/Hall 3.1, AXYZ International will demonstrate the Trident CNC combined routing and cutting system. The machine incorporates a triple-head routing/cutting configuration comprising a high-performance routing spindle and combined tangential/oscillating knife-cutting units.

Key design features of Trident include a rigid solid steel frame construction to better accommodate more vigorous machine operation, an exclusive live vacuum deck that provides a maximum material hold-down capability and an integrated helical rack and pinion drive system. This latter feature incorporates a multiple gear teeth configuration that ensures more even distribution of the workload and radically reduced machine wear that enables greatly enhanced routing/cutting precision and ultimately a longer than normal machine life. Interchangeable 120mm-long blade attachments provide increased cutting efficiency when processing harder, thicker and heavier materials.

Trident will handle a diverse range of rigid and flexible materials, including aluminium and other non-ferrous metals, aluminium composites (ACM), acrylic and plastic, foamed and corrugated board, vinyl, cardboard and paper.
